Paul Gascoigne reveals what he used to tell Roy Keane on the pitch to wind him up 

Tottenham legend Paul Gascoigne has admitted that he used to talk to Roy Keane during games to wind him up and even once told the former Manchester United midfielder that he was sleeping with his wife.

Gascoigne is regarded by many to be one of the most talented footballers that England has ever produced.

The former Spurs midfielder produced moments of magic with regularity and was capable of single-handedly taking the game away from the opposition in a blink of an eye.

However, it is fair to say that Gazza is remembered as much for his colourful personality as he is for his ability with the ball at his feet.

The 53-year-old revealed that he often used to talk to the players he came up against in matches and a young Keane, who was just making a name for himself in the professional game was one of his prime targets at the time.

Gascoigne said during his appearance on Anything Goes with James English (via The Daily Mail): “I remember Roy Keane once, I just used to talk to him all the time.

“I remember going down the tunnel and I said: ‘Roy, you reckon you’re the new kid on the block? Welcome to your worst nightmare.’

“We won one-nil but he said afterwards in the papers: ‘Thank God that game is over with. I’ve never been talked to so much in my life.’

“I used to say: ‘I’m sleeping with your wife’.”
